Title: Leveraging Big Data for Environmental Analysis and Conservation

In recent years, the integration of big data analytics in environmental research and conservation efforts has become increasingly prevalent. Let's delve into how big data is being utilized in the field of environmental conservation and analysis.

1.

Data Collection and Monitoring

环保大数据分析员-第1张图片-彩蝶百科

One of the primary uses of big data in environmental analysis is data collection and monitoring. Various sensors, satellites, and IoT devices collect massive amounts of data related to weather patterns, air and water quality, deforestation, wildlife migration, and more. This realtime data collection allows researchers and conservationists to track changes and identify trends over time.

2.

Predictive Modeling

Big data analytics enable the development of predictive models that can forecast environmental changes and their potential impacts. For example, climate models use historical and realtime data to predict future climate scenarios, helping policymakers and environmental agencies make informed decisions about mitigation strategies and adaptation measures.
